Refinancing Your 2025 Car Loan: When and How
As the auto industry continues to evolve, the landscape of car financing is also in flux. If you’ve already secured an auto loan for your EV, it’s worth considering the potential benefits of refinancing. In 2025, interest rates and loan terms may have shifted, and you could potentially score a better deal by renegotiating your financing.
When should you consider refinancing your 2025 car loan? Keep an eye on market trends and your personal financial situation. If interest rates have dropped or your credit score has improved, it may be an opportune time to explore refinancing options. By securing a lower interest rate or more favorable loan terms, you can save money over the life of your loan and potentially free up funds for other financial goals.
To get started with refinancing, reach out to your current lender or shop around for the best deals. Be prepared to provide updated financial information, such as your current income, credit score, and the remaining balance on your loan. By taking the time to explore refinancing, you can ensure that your auto loan aligns with your long-term financial objectives.
Navigating the Evolving EV Financing Landscape
As the adoption of electric vehicles continues to grow, the auto loan landscape is also evolving to cater to this emerging market. In 2025, you can expect to see a wider range of financing options tailored specifically to EV buyers, each with its own set of advantages and considerations.
Traditional Auto Loans: The tried-and-true method of financing a vehicle, traditional auto loans from banks, credit unions, and dealerships, will still be a popular choice for EV buyers in 2025. These loans typically offer competitive interest rates and flexible terms, making them a reliable option for those with strong credit profiles.
EV-Specific Financing: Recognizing the unique needs of EV owners, some lenders may offer specialized financing packages in 2025. These could include longer loan terms, lower interest rates, or even incentives tied to the environmental benefits of electric vehicles. By exploring these EV-centric options, you may be able to secure more favorable terms and maximize the affordability of your dream car.
Leasing Opportunities: For those who prefer a more flexible approach, leasing an EV may be an attractive option in 2025. Leasing can provide lower monthly payments, the ability to upgrade to the latest models, and the convenience of not having to worry about resale value. As the EV market matures, you can expect to see a wider range of leasing programs tailored to the needs of eco-conscious consumers.
